An actress with a career spanning various film genres, recognized for a significant role in 'The Dreamlife of Angels'. Received critical acclaim for performances in both French and American cinema, contributing to notable projects in the industry.

Starred in 'The Dreamlife of Angels'

Won the César Award for Most Promising Actress in 1999
